Hi:

I downloaded and installed Cygwin32 B20.1.  I have been unable to
suspend jobs under bash.
The control-Z character to suspend jobs does not seem to work.  Please
let me know
how to make this work.  Thanks in advance.

- Young

I bet ^C is also killing jobs placed in the background
by invocation with an &

Make sure there are no quotation marks in the
set CYGWIN=
line of cygnus.bat, and make sure you're starting things
off with the bat file, and not invoking bash directly.
